What QHSM does

The VanEck MSCI International Small Companies Quality (AUD Hedged) ETF, with the ticker QHSM, invests in a diverse range of small companies from around the world, focusing on those with strong financial health and quality business practices. This ETF aims to provide Australian investors with exposure to international small-cap stocks while reducing currency risk through hedging, meaning it tries to protect against fluctuations in the Australian dollar. With a management fee of 0.62%, QHSM is designed for those looking to diversify their portfolio by including high-quality, smaller international companies, potentially offering growth opportunities beyond the Australian market.
